INTRO


Below you will find parts and tools, which will help you to add turn and stop signals to your bicycle. Not all tools, like multimeter or label printer, are necessary. If you noticed mistakes, have questions or suggestions, know better components (available in EU and US), please write to [email protected] • Project page: Jocys.com/bicycle

Parts were printed from PETG with Prusa3D i3 MK3 Printer. If your printer is not precise enough, printed parts may not fit into each other.

If you made your own updates or (file) changes, related to this project, please send me a link. I will add this link to your work on this page.

This project is based on 12 Volts. Bicycle dynamos and lights are, usually, 6 Volts. USB is 5 Volts. Be careful and don't mix wires.

image Shin Yo • 255-700 Universal Stop and Taillight OVAL
1 x Shin Yo Oval Universal Stop and Tail Light (12v 21/5w bulb)
image You should change standard halogen or incandescent bulbs to LED bulbs. Some LED bulbs are larger than standard halogen or incandescent bulbs and will not fit inside.
image LUYED (China) 1157 3014 78-EX red LED bulb: Brighter than OSRAM LED bulb. All LEDs are lit in “tail only” mode. On pressing brake lever (“stop” mode), all LEDs become brighter. Difference between “tail only” and “stop” mode is minimal and not very distinguishable. You can increased difference between “tail only” and “stop” modes by dimming tail light slightly with 1 kΩ potentiometer.
image image Osram (Germany) • 1457R red LED bulb: Not as bright as LUYED LED bulb. Only 6 LEDs are lit in “tail only” mode. On pressing brake lever (“stop” mode), another 12 LEDs light up. Not as bright as LUYED bulb in both modes, but difference between “tail only” and “stop” modes is more distinguishable without dimming tail light with 1 kΩ potentiometer. Currently I prefer LUYED with 1 kΩ potentiometer setup.

image CTS Corporation • 026TB32R102B1A1 1 kΩ Potentiometer
1 x 1 kΩ potentiometer for tail light
Some LED bulbs have very small difference between “tail only” and “stop” modes. You can increase this difference by slightly dimming tail light with 1 kΩ potentiometer.

image WASD • O-Ring Switch Dampeners
4 x Blue o-ring (optional)
Stop light didn't turn-off with my "noname" brake levers sometimes. I added 2 blue o-rings (2 x 0.4mm = 0.8mm Reduction) under each switch to fix it.

PETG FILAMENT

You will need about 1.1 kg with 80% infill
I would not recommend to print parts from ABS (shrinkage is too big) or PLA (low heat resistance).

PRINTING SETTINGS

Printing Settings for MCPP BasicFil or AmazonBasics PETG Filament on PrusaSlicer
...for Spring Steel Sheet with Smooth Double-sided PEI

For BIG parts to stick on TEXTURED PEI Powder-coated Spring Steel Sheet sheet, I increased recommended bed temperature from 60-80°C (for AmazonBasic and MCPP BasicFill PETG filaments) to 85°C (First layer) and 90°C (Other layers). I printed BIG parts in my own Temperature Controlled Enclosure. Temperature inside enclosure was about 35°C with these bed settings. E3D V6 HotEnd is rated to 40°C ambient operating temperature. As you approach that temperature, cooling efficiency is reduced, allowing more heat up past the heatbreak. This can cause low temperature filament to soften in the mechanism to cause feed problems.

image Modified settings: PrusaSlicer ► Print Settings ► 0.20 QUALITY MK3 ► Layers and perimeters
• "Ensure vertical shell thickness: disabled" - I had problems with thin 45° hanging angles when it was enabled.
• "Perimeters: 6" - infill pattern is less visible on surface.
• "Seam position: Rear" - created line at the back of the parts, but front and side surfaces were perfectly smooth.
image
image Modified settings: PrusaSlicer ► Print Settings ► 0.20 QUALITY MK3 ► Inflill
• "Fill density: 80%."
image
image Modified settings: PrusaSlicer ► Print Settings ► 0.20 QUALITY MK3 ► Speed
• Reduced printing speeds (10-20-180-400). Slower speeds results in smoother and glossier surfaces without matte areas, reduces printing noise with vibrations... lesser probability for corners of big parts to unstick from heated bed, because of shrinking.
• "Travel: 180" - low speeds (like 20) creates surface blobs after long travel distances.
• "First layer speed: 10" - for better adhesion.
image
image Modified settings: PrusaSlicer ► Printer Settings ► Original Prusa i3 MK3S ► Custom G-code
• I added few lines to G-code to remove filament blob on nozzle right before printing starts and raised intro line to reduce wearing of steel sheet plate surface.

G0 Z50 ; ADDED LINE - NOZZLE BLOB - Z up 50 mm to clean filament blob from nozzle before printing.
G4 S5 ; ADDED LINE - NOZZLE BLOB - Pause 5 seconds to clean the nozzle.
G0 Z-50 ; ADDED LINE - NOZZLE BLOB - Z down 50 mm to initial position.
G0 Z0.5 ; ADDED LINE - INTRO LINE - Z up 0.5 mm for less intro line adhesion to prevent steel sheet plate surface from wearing.
G0 Y-1 ; ADDED LINE - INTRO LINE - Y shift 2 mm intro line default start position to prevent steel sheet plate surface from wearing.
